Solange Knowles brightened up the streets of London last week with her colourful, eclectic style.
The singer was in town performing at XOYO to promote her new album, ‘True’.
You may remember we had print overload the last time out, so I’m delighted Solange opted this time to mix prints with solids.
I’m sure you instantly spied her retro-inspired Miu Miu Fall 2012 ensemble, with a purple, camel and pale-blue print.
To add to the 70s sensibility of the look, she donned an Alberta Ferretti teal, purple and pink patterned twill coat.
White t-bar ankle-strap pumps and a yellow scarf completed her look.
